Lee Gustin Obituary

Obituary published on Legacy.com by Highland Park Funeral Home and Crematory on Mar. 19, 2026.
Lee Frederick Gustin

PD- March 15th 2026

DOB- February 27th 1956

Born in Kansas City, Kansas

Passed away at Brunswick Healthcare Center in Brunswick Missouri

Born on February 27th, 1956 in Kansas City, Kansas, he was the son of late Charles Gustoin SR. and Wanda Gustin.

Lee served in the Marines from 1974 to 1978. He also worked as a tow truck operator for 15 years.

He lived in Kansas City, Kansas his entire life and loved his family. He was a family man and enjoyed every minute with them all. His love for animals was beyond measure.

Survivors include, Linda Gustin, two sons, Anothony Dickerson (Rosa) of Ida, Kansas and Eric Dickerson (Courtney) of Marshall Missouri. Four daughters, Lisa Rafols, Cheryl Gustin of Lebanon, Missouri, Danielle Morris of Kansas City, Kansas and Patricia Stewart (Thomas) of Stillwater, Oklahoma. Numerous grandchildren, One great grandchild Kamdyn Jolliff. two Sisters, Rita Whisenand of Kansas City, Kansas and Linda Wildburger of Kansas City, Missouri. one brother, Charles (Pops) Gustin Jr of Kansas City, Kansas and numerous nieces and nephews.

In addition to his parents he was preceded by in death two grandsons, one granddaughter, two sisters Donna Talbert and Beverly Collins.
